Output 75f63b045151bb2c018510aef2fced409c821180e3e5e8b3a8d7d6e7eb4aaaa6:15

value
11473847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f4dfb529ecea604e539d643d92e9062a681bff4 OP_EQUAL
address
34YYHkobRmyi3AzwdMgp36vHYmTy3BWR1w
transaction
75f63b045151bb2c018510aef2fced409c821180e3e5e8b3a8d7d6e7eb4aaaa6
spent
true